The increasing prevalence of cardiovascular diseases (CVDs), technological advancements in stent materials, and growing demand for minimally invasive procedures are driving market growth. Bioabsorbable vascular stents (BVS) are designed to dissolve naturally in the body over time, reducing the risk of long-term complications associated with traditional metallic stents.
The market is witnessing significant
research and development efforts to improve biocompatibility, strength, and
degradation time, leading to more efficient next-generation bioabsorbable
stents. The rise in geriatric population, growing adoption of percutaneous
coronary interventions (PCI), and increasing awareness regarding advanced stent
technologies are further propelling the market forward.
Market Drivers
1. Rising Prevalence of Cardiovascular
Diseases (CVDs)
The increasing incidence of coronary artery
disease (CAD), heart attacks, and other cardiovascular conditions is a
significant driver for the bioabsorbable vascular stents market. With sedentary
lifestyles, poor dietary habits, and rising obesity rates, the demand for
effective and safe vascular stenting solutions continues to grow.
2. Technological Advancements in Stent
Materials
Bioabsorbable stents are evolving with
advanced polymer and metallic materials that provide better biodegradation
rates, reduced inflammation, and enhanced vascular healing. The introduction of
drug-eluting bioabsorbable stents (DES-BVS) has significantly improved patient outcomes
by preventing restenosis (narrowing of arteries).
3. Growing Demand for Minimally Invasive
Procedures
Minimally invasive angioplasty procedures
using bioabsorbable stents are becoming a preferred alternative to traditional
open-heart surgeries. These stents eliminate the long-term complications
associated with permanent metallic implants and enhance post-procedural
recovery.
Market Restraints
1. High Cost of Bioabsorbable Stents
Compared to traditional metallic stents,
bioabsorbable vascular stents are relatively expensive, which limits their
adoption, particularly in developing regions. The high cost is primarily due to
R&D expenses, material innovation, and regulatory approval processes.
2. Regulatory Challenges and Approval
Delays
Stringent FDA and CE Mark approvals pose a
significant barrier to market expansion. The lack of long-term clinical data
supporting bioabsorbable stents has resulted in hesitancy among physicians and
healthcare providers in adopting these technologies.
3. Risk of Stent Thrombosis
Despite advancements, bioabsorbable stents
still face challenges related to thrombosis risk, where blood clots can form
around the stent, potentially leading to adverse cardiovascular events.
Continued research is necessary to improve the safety profile of these stents.
Market Opportunity
1. Emerging Markets in Asia-Pacific and
Latin America
Developing regions such as China, India,
Brazil, and Mexico present significant growth opportunities due to rising
healthcare infrastructure investments, growing awareness, and increasing
healthcare expenditure.
2. Innovations in Next-Generation Stent
Technology
Advancements in 3D printing, biodegradable
coatings, and hybrid stents with drug-eluting capabilities provide significant
market expansion opportunities. The integration of artificial intelligence (AI)
and robotics in stent placement is expected to further revolutionize the field.
3. Expansion of Personalized Medicine in
Cardiology
The development of customized,
patient-specific stents using biodegradable polymers is a growing area of
focus. Personalized medicine aims to optimize treatment outcomes based on
individual patient anatomy and pathology.
Market by Material Type Insights
Based on material type, the Polymer-Based
Stents segment dominated the market in 2023, owing to their high
biocompatibility, controlled degradation, and superior flexibility. Metal-Based
Stents (Magnesium Alloy) are also gaining traction due to their better
mechanical strength and faster absorption rate compared to polymer-based
alternatives.
